Output 7fba02c3e7cd26fa83c69664679e1199d0b9fc27843246d8fd4101cffaeb9452:2

value
10645028
script pubkey
OP_0 OP_PUSHBYTES_32 18d77efc0f73086fbc8ca238d75bd6508aed11ffbb94eda6d7e050ea555fc2a2
address
bc1qrrthalq0wvyxl0yv5gudwk7k2z9w6y0lhw2wmfkhupgw542lc23qlarmlz
transaction
7fba02c3e7cd26fa83c69664679e1199d0b9fc27843246d8fd4101cffaeb9452